WW2 British Army Colonel Bath Star Rank Badges maple leaf insignia Instituted March 1898An original set of shoulder board rank badges of a British Army Colonel. Two gilded brass Imperial Crowns with maroon backing. Along with four gilded brass and enamel Bath Star pips. Each with lug mounts and supplied with mount pins. Very good condition. The pips retaining bright gilding.
